Scott Frederick
10d71f5645
Document how to get socket location for podman configuration
...
Closes gh-34435
2023-03-03 16:47:48 -06:00
Phillip Webb
4370757fb2
Use Java 17 in Maven integration tests
...
Closes gh-34472
2023-03-03 10:59:00 -08:00
Andy Wilkinson
5c43e42839
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34470
2023-03-03 16:27:49 +00:00
Andy Wilkinson
95cd0f2435
Test Boot's Maven Plugin against Maven 3.9.0
...
Closes gh-34469
2023-03-03 16:27:02 +00:00
Andy Wilkinson
6a95f44f67
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34462
2023-03-03 10:47:08 +00:00
Andy Wilkinson
68a1dd3a76
Document support for Gradle 8
...
Closes gh-34458
2023-03-03 10:42:28 +00:00
Andy Wilkinson
03dd666818
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34460
2023-03-03 10:27:32 +00:00
Andy Wilkinson
4f7e038f14
Test Gradle plugin against Gradle 8.0.1
...
Closes gh-34457
2023-03-03 10:21:26 +00:00
Phillip Webb
956b9e06c9
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34452
2023-03-02 12:08:52 -08:00
Phillip Webb
69d34c96bf
Apply consistent timestamps to files added to a fat archive
...
Update logic in `BootZipCopyAction` to align with the recent changes
made in the Maven plugin (commit 998d59b7). Timestamps are now
specified in UTC and offset against the default timezone before being
written.
Removing the offset from our UTC time before calling `entry.setTime()`
ensures that we get consistent bytes in the zip file when the output
stream reapplies the offset during write.
Closes gh-21005
2023-03-02 12:06:42 -08:00
Phillip Webb
f5cf821479
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34430
2023-03-01 21:28:51 -08:00
Phillip Webb
998d59b7ac
Ignore system timezone when applying outputTimestamp to entries
...
Update `JarWriter` so that entry times are set with the default TimeZone
offset removed. The Javadoc for `ZipEntry.setTime` states:
The file entry is "encoded in standard `MS-DOS date and time format`.
The default TimeZone is used to convert the epoch time to the MS-DOS
data and time.
Removing the offset from our UTC time before calling `entry.setTime()`
ensures that we get consistent bytes in the zip file when the output
stream reapplies the offset during write.
Fixes gh-34424
2023-03-01 21:27:08 -08:00
Andy Wilkinson
814b77c33f
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34391
2023-02-27 13:54:59 +00:00
Andy Wilkinson
81882ecca4
Apply plugins consistently in Gradle documentation examples
...
Closes gh-34038
2023-02-27 13:26:05 +00:00
Andy Wilkinson
eb105572f6
Test Gradle plugin against Gradle 6.9.4
...
Closes gh-34368
2023-02-24 10:36:08 +00:00
Phillip Webb
0b15962aca
Merge branch '2.7.x' into 3.0.x
2023-02-22 18:36:16 -08:00
Phillip Webb
a5902d7a00
Update copyright year of changed files
2023-02-22 18:35:17 -08:00
Phillip Webb
c4de86c244
Merge branch '2.7.x' into 3.0.x
2023-02-21 23:17:57 -08:00
Phillip Webb
df5898a146
Reformat code following spring-javaformat upgrade
2023-02-21 22:53:27 -08:00
Johnny Lim
d368115128
Fix name for Implementation-Title in Spring Boot Gradle plugin
...
See gh-34177
2023-02-14 19:47:43 +00:00
Scott Frederick
cbac3c81d6
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34161
2023-02-09 15:47:34 -06:00
Scott Frederick
33aef7fe27
Update CLI installation docs to download releases from Maven Central
...
Closes gh-33962
2023-02-09 15:45:15 -06:00
Andy Wilkinson
9378fc47a7
Set implementation name and version in Gradle-built archives
...
Closes gh-34059
2023-02-08 10:59:55 +00:00
Moritz Halbritter
2e61acb979
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34072
2023-02-06 11:54:51 +01:00
Enimiste
d6032c9d2c
Remove inputStream.close() line to conform to the interface
...
The "ReproducibleResourceTransformer" interface says that "An input
stream for the resource, the implementation should *not* close this
stream".
See gh-34063
2023-02-06 11:47:25 +01:00
Moritz Halbritter
0a080736d8
Merge branch '2.7.x' into 3.0.x
...
Closes gh-34017
2023-01-31 10:50:30 +01:00
Johnny Lim
bc7fc90550
Replace Base64Utils with JDK's Base64
...
See gh-33967
2023-01-31 10:20:06 +01:00
Krzysztof Krason
94996664bc
Drop unnecessary Collections.unmodifiableSet
...
See gh-33987
2023-01-26 20:47:35 -08:00
Krzysztof Krason
d3efd7e091
Use try with close
...
See gh-33987
2023-01-26 20:36:38 -08:00
Krzysztof Krason
0e68cae57f
Use instanceof patterns
...
See gh-33987
2023-01-26 20:36:25 -08:00
Krzysztof Krason
a9c547e767
Use text blocks
...
See gh-33987
2023-01-26 20:36:01 -08:00
Krzysztof Krason
6e46423983
Use diamond operators
...
See gh-33987
2023-01-26 20:35:08 -08:00
Moritz Halbritter
dfda153da5
Merge branch '2.7.x' into 3.0.x
...
Closes gh-33963
2023-01-24 10:09:01 +01:00
Phillip Webb
71efc55bf9
Merge branch '2.7.x'
2023-01-18 16:31:53 -08:00
Phillip Webb
470a255b0d
Polish
2023-01-18 15:47:50 -08:00
Phillip Webb
7c508fa324
Update copyright year of changed files
2023-01-18 15:37:58 -08:00
Moritz Halbritter
94f4a4396c
Merge branch '2.7.x'
...
Closes gh-33880
2023-01-18 17:35:52 +01:00
Moritz Halbritter
e8d809fe65
Replace 'via' with 'over' or 'through' in the documentation
...
Closes gh-33878
2023-01-18 16:56:42 +01:00
Moritz Halbritter
fe8d8f4ed3
Merge branch '2.7.x'
2023-01-18 13:50:06 +01:00
Moritz Halbritter
524a4b6c1e
Only return complete accessor name when accessor has a backing field
2023-01-18 13:42:56 +01:00
Moritz Halbritter
ae64b205d4
Merge branch '2.7.x'
...
Closes gh-33871
2023-01-18 12:08:58 +01:00
Moritz Halbritter
26d658802f
Add support for record accessors in spring-boot-configuration-processor
...
Closes gh-29526
2023-01-18 12:02:34 +01:00
Moritz Halbritter
6c44055fd4
Polish PropertyDescriptorResolver
2023-01-18 12:01:06 +01:00
Moritz Halbritter
b1f8024e8a
Merge branch '2.7.x'
...
Closes gh-33845
2023-01-16 16:06:44 +01:00
Moritz Halbritter
9f2ed201b2
Improve error message when start goal can't contact running application
...
Closes gh-24044
2023-01-16 15:58:03 +01:00
Moritz Halbritter
d26fa80741
Merge branch '2.7.x'
...
Closes gh-33843
2023-01-16 14:10:35 +01:00
Moritz Halbritter
6cec0187c3
Include exception message in condition result when docker is unavailable
...
Closes gh-20582
2023-01-16 14:09:21 +01:00
Andy Wilkinson
485025310e
Merge branch '2.7.x'
...
Closes gh-33777
2023-01-12 12:04:04 +00:00
Andy Wilkinson
433364601d
Merge branch '2.7.x'
2023-01-11 17:04:33 +00:00
Andy Wilkinson
3b2e5e5292
Remove references to https://repo.spring.io/release
2023-01-11 17:03:45 +00:00